МенеджерКриптографии.НачатьШифрование (CryptoManager.BeginEncrypting)
МенеджерКриптографии (CryptoManager)
НачатьШифрование (BeginEncrypting)
Доступен, начиная с версии 8.3.6.
Вариант синтаксиса: Данные в возвращаемом значении
Синтаксис:
НачатьШифрование(<ОписаниеОповещения>, <ИсходныеДанные>, <Получатели>)Параметры:
<ОписаниеОповещения> (обязательный)
Содержит описание процедуры, которая будет вызвана после завершения шифрования данных со следующими параметрами:
- <ПодписанныеДанные> - зашифрованные данные типа ДвоичныеДанные.
- <ДополнительныеПараметры> - значение, которое было указано при создании объекта ОписаниеОповещения.
<ИсходныеДанные> (обязательный)
Исходные данные для шифрования.
Данные могут размещаться в файле (в этом случае указывается имя файла) или представлены как ДвоичныеДанные, Поток, ПотокВПамяти или ФайловыйПоток.
<Получатели> (обязательный)
Параметр может содержать один сертификат или массив сертификатов.
Только получатели из указанного списка (получатели, обладающие переданными сертификатами) смогут расшифровать данные, используя свои закрытые ключи.
Описание варианта метода:
Начинает шифрование данных для определенного круга получателей. Только получатели из указанного списка смогут расшифровать данные, используя свои закрытые ключи.Формат зашифрованных данных - CMS (базируется на PKCS#7).
Используется алгоритм, заданный в свойстве АлгоритмШифрования. После завершения шифрования будет вызвана процедура. имя которой указано в ОписаниеОповещения.
В процедуре, указанной в параметре ОписаниеОповещения, должны присутствовать параметры:
- <ЗашифрованныеДанные> - зашифрованные данные типа ДвоичныеДанные.
- <ДополнительныеПараметры>.
Вариант синтаксиса: Сохранение данных в файл
Синтаксис:
НачатьШифрование(<ОписаниеОповещения>, <ИсходныеДанные>, <ВыходныеДанные>, <Получатели>)Параметры:
<ОписаниеОповещения> (обязательный)
Содержит описание процедуры, которая будет вызвана после завершения шифрования данных со следующими параметрами:
- <ИмяФайла> - имя файла, в который осуществлен вывод.
- <ДополнительныеПараметры> - значение, которое было указано при создании объекта ОписаниеОповещения.
<ИсходныеДанные> (обязательный)
Исходные данные для шифрования.
Данные могут размещаться в файле (в этом случае указывается имя файла) или представлены как ДвоичныеДанные, Поток, ПотокВПамяти или ФайловыйПоток.
<ВыходныеДанные> (обязательный)
Имя файла, в который будут выгружены зашифрованные данные.
<Получатели> (обязательный)
Параметр может содержать один сертификат или массив объектов сертификатов.
Только получатели из указанного списка (получатели, обладающие переданными сертификатами) смогут расшифровать данные, используя свои закрытые ключи.
Описание варианта метода:
Зашифрованные данные записываются в файл.Описание:
Начинает шифрование данных для определенного круга получателей. Только получатели из указанного списка смогут расшифровать данные, используя свои закрытые ключи.
Формат зашифрованных данных - CMS (базируется на PKCS#7).
Размер входных данных для шифрования ограничен 2 Гб (2147483647 байт).
Используется алгоритм, заданный в свойстве АлгоритмШифрования.
После завершения шифрования, будет вызвана процедура. имя которой указано в ОписаниеОповещения.
Доступность:
Тонкий клиент, веб-клиент, мобильный клиент, сервер, толстый клиент, внешнее соединение, мобильное приложение (клиент), мобильное приложение (сервер), мобильный автономный сервер.
См. также:
МенеджерКриптографии, метод ЗашифроватьМенеджерКриптографии, метод ЗашифроватьАсинх
Использование в версии:
Доступен, начиная с версии 8.3.6.
Описание изменено в версии 8.3.27.